The Absolute Basics For Selling Your House

The time has come for you to sell your home. You’ve made the necessary upgrades to ensure optimum return. You’ve made the decision to sell it yourself, bypassing a real estate agent and their fees. You want to be sure that you’re going to hit the market prepared.

There are basic things you need to do to sell your home or investment property. Devoting time to these basics will improve your chances of selling your property quickly. Properly performed, these activities will make the selling process an easier task for you. It will also make the buying process easier for your potential buyers.

First off, get the word out that you are selling. Trumpet that fact like a swing-era horn line. Put a sign on the front lawn. Tried and true, but effective. Tell people you meet, so they can tell people they meet. They may know family or friends who are shopping for something in the vicinity. They may as well check you out while they’re at it.

Advertise in the local paper, on the grocery store bulletin board and on the World Wide Web. There are online home listing sites you can exploit that cater to private sales.

While on the web, why not check out resources to help you market your property properly. Check online sites that teach proper selling techniques and systems for selling a home. Research sites that offer tutorials on the basics of promoting real estate.

Make up inexpensive, but professional looking flyers that advertise your home or investment property. You want to get information in front of as many people as possible. Remember, you won’t have the resources to get the exposure you want as a real estate agent does. You will have to work hard and think smart, to make it known you’re selling your property.

An addendum to the above is if you’re in a high demand area, with a high demand house because of its features. You won’t need the exposure that would normally be required. It’s the perfect scenario for a fast sale because of the quality of the product, and location, location, location.

Make sure the market price you set reflects time on the market. You may want to price lower to encourage a quick sale. You’re saving real estate fees anyway so you may be able to take a bit less.

If you decide you want to ask more, you may have to risk the house being on the market longer. With that, you have the extra carrying costs and the impact it will have on your final profit.

Now the games begin. Before showings or open houses make sure you remove all personal effects, within reason, from view. This includes family photos and ‘unique’ (re: bizarre, strange) knick-knacks. You want the house to appear as being neutral. You want it to appeal to the widest audience. Most homebuyers cannot see past the clutter or the personal ambience you’ve created for your home.

Therefore, de-clutter. Spaciousness is a selling feature. Create a feeling of openness. Let the walk through the house flow easily from room to room, as much as you possibly can.

Stay out of the way when people view your house, but be available for any questions they may have. Let them feel comfortable and not hovered over. Don’t act like a salesperson ready to attack in a shoe store. If you have children or pets make sure they are elsewhere as potential buyers wander about.

Institute the above suggestions to give yourself the best chance to sell your home or investment property quickly. Think, also, of times you attended showings and open houses and what things the seller did that appealed to you. Do the same. Think back on any model homes you viewed and how the builders’ displayed them. Do the same.

Applying the above principles will present your property in the best light. You may find that selling a house or investment property can actually be an enjoyable experience. You may find that your home sends the right signals and catches a buyer’s eye right away.

You may find that potential buyer anteing up and making you an offer you can’t refuse.

How to Make Realtors “FIGHT OVER” Selling Your House

Last week I discussed ways that you can promote selling your house and options that you may not have known about to sell your house without a Realtor. Today I want to talk to you about a technique that we use often to get our properties sold quickly.

This technique will often create a “feeding frenzy” among real estate agents and it will get your property a lot more showings than the “typical” showings that a real estate agent does. And in today’s market more showings lead to more offers which leads to a sale. Although this technique does not get you out of paying a real estate agent fee, it will help in selling the house faster. To explain this technique first I will need to explain how a regular real estate agent agreement works, then I will explain how we do it.

In a typical real estate listing, the listing (or seller’s agent) comes to your house tells you what they think your house is worth and then you sign a listing agreement with them and you agree that at the sale of your property you will pay them a 5-6% commission. The agent then list your house on the MLS (Multiple Listing Service) which allows all the other Realtors to see that your house is for sale. Your agent then works to find a buyer or another agent that has a buyer. Once they show your house and find a buyer, you get to sell your house.

In this scenario you look like every other seller out their on the market. You have just as much chance of selling your house as anyone else who is selling their house. In today’s market you need to have something that will make your property stand out from the other properties.

You need something that will make real estate agents WANT to sell your house first. The answer to this is simple… Pay a HIGHER commission. Tell the listing agent that you want to give a $1,000 bonus to the agent that finds you a buyer. If all the agents have a choice between selling someone else’s house and selling your house they would probably try and sell yours first for the $1,000 bonus in addition to their regular commission.

I even go a step further and say that I will pay the $1,000 bonus to any agent that finds me a buyer and gets me a signed contract within the first 30 days of the listing. This way agents will try and get you a buyer first before the other houses in the area. You only pay the bonus if their buyer actually closes. And, if you think about it, it makes good sense.

If your house can sell within the first 30 days that allows you to not have to pay another mortgage payment and if your mortgage payment were $1,500 a month for example you just saved $500 dollars and a large headache. With this technique you will literally have agents fighting to find a buyer for your house because they want that bonus. Try this technique it works great. What Costs Are Involved in Selling a House Or Flat?

Now that we have established that there are significant benefits to selling your house, let us take a look at the particular costs that are involved in selling your house:

Standing home loan – It goes without saying that a homeowner who has taken out a mortgage or two on their home is in no position to sell the house for as long as they have not completely paid off the loan. Carefully plan out how you intend to complete the payment to your standing loan, since there are lenders that practice giving a penalty to early payers, as strange as that may be to some. Also consider that there may be some other fees and payments that need to be dealt with before your loan is completely settled, so it may be a good idea to get in writing every payment included in settling the loan, just so that there is no confusion or loose ends that are left.

Commission – Money that goes to the broker, known as the commission is often the largest expense in the entire process of selling a house, ranging anywhere from 5% to 7% of the selling price. Different real estate agencies will typically charge different rates, so it may be a good idea to ask around and see which particular real estate agencies can offer you a god deal, or that agency where you stand to get the most value for what they charge. Some real estate agencies will even allow a homeowner to market their own homes, although unless you have a natural gift for selling, the sales industry is hardly a place for amateurs.

Closing expense – Following the amount that goes into the commission of the broker who helped sell your house, another significant expenditure is the closing cost. Closing costs are typically made up of the title insurance expense, which is a huge amount in itself, pro-rated property taxes, which is rarely anywhere near the amount you expect it to be, document preparation fees, and, of course, legal fees for the services of a lawyer. Closing costs are rarely standard, so be sure to get a good estimate well ahead of the due date of closing.

Tips on How to Make Your House Sell Quick Besides Selling it For Cheap

Selling something as substantial as a house may sound like something that is easier said than done, let alone selling it quickly, but it is still quite possible, provided you know the proper way to sell the house. Just like most things, people are always on the lookout for good buys, and that includes investments as major as buying a house. A look at the most recent classified ads will confirm this fact, and if this is to be used a gauge for market viability, then real estate would seem to be a sector that is not as hard hit by the recession as the rest, considering how many homes are being put up for sale on the market.

Still, the question that is pertinent for anyone who would want to seize this opportunity to make a sale is: what do you need to do to make your house sell quickly, and maybe make a real profit at the soonest time?

Get a professional – If you are not a seasoned and experienced realtor, then it may be a good idea to contract the services of one. This should be someone whom you deem to be quite trustworthy, since this person will be the one who will be selling your house. It only stands to reason that this person takes the initiative to keep you abreast of just how many potential buyers you have, if your targeted price is being met, just how close to making an actual sales this realtor is.

Do a walk-through of the house – Typically important because any self-respecting realtor will NOT try to sell your property without even trying to look at it personally, and by personally, that means they have actually been to your house to give it a thorough analysis. They will assess the value of your house in terms of scalability. Considering the fact that they also stand to make a profit by being able to actually sell your house, this walk-through is as important to them as it is to you, so be on hand for the assessment and take into consideration the estimates they say.

You may not be an expert on the field, but you should have an idea of just how much your home stands to fetch in the market. If you feel that your house is being priced at an unbelievably low price, ask the realtor why they think that is the worth of your house. Ask If the realtor for any suggestions to make the value of the house appreciate even more, as they may have some last minute fixes that may jack up the sell price of your house.

Cleanliness is next to scalability – This almost needs no explanation at all. Who would want to purchase a property that looks like a garbage dump or a landfill? You should really ensure that both the outside and the inside of your house is clean as a whistle. Just like most things on sale on the market, the front of the house says a lot about the house itself. For one, a clean, well kept front is a terrific way to make a good impression to potentials buyers. A good impression is often a good way to hook them in, just enough for the realtor to throw in the sales pitch and convince them to buy the house.

Bring in the light – One of the first things the realtor may suggest is to give the house being sold a fresh coat of paint, and choice of paint color is a significant part of your efforts to make your house sell quick. Unless you are planning to sell to some shady characters, such as mob bosses looking for a discrete hideaway, someone in the witness protection program, or maybe an undead European aristocrat, painting the house in dark, dreary, and drab house paint colors is not really advised. The walls should be painted in either white, or in case you don’t want that antiseptic look, off-white colors that are bright enough to attract prospective buyers without really looking sterile. In case the house is actually quite wanting in space and size, painting the house in bright colors may even give it the impression of being larger than it really is.

Clean out the inside – Unless you are still living inside the house when it is being sold, and unless you also plan on throwing in your furniture. Completely clean out the house of any and all indications of occupancy. Try to make it appear as brand new as possible, as this actually adds to the sale value of the house. This will also give a spacious area to move around and allow potential buyers to visualize where they can put in their stuff. A lot of people are like this, and a lot of sales were actually closed thanks to the buyer seeing a viable house for their personal items.
